Deep learning, a subset of machine learning, employs neural networks with multiple layers to interpret complex data structures. When applied to website traffic, models like Long Short-Term Memory (LSTM), Gated Recurrent Units (GRU), and Convolutional Neural Networks (CNN) excel at capturing temporal dependencies and spatial patterns.
For example, LSTM networks are particularly adept at understanding sequential data, making them ideal for predicting future traffic based on past observations. These models can consider multiple variables simultaneously—such as time of day, day of the week, marketing campaigns, and even external factors like weather or news events—thereby generating highly accurate forecasts.
Deploying deep learning models requires a robust data infrastructure. Businesses must collect, preprocess, and organize data from various sources, including server logs, analytics platforms, and third-party feeds. Once prepared, models can be trained and validated on historical data, with ongoing tuning to adapt to new patterns.
